Spirit of India Tour (09 Nights / 11 Days)


Visit north India’s most famous and magnificent sites. Wonder at the British colonial architecture of the nation’s capital, New Delhi. Enjoy a Rickshaw ride in the narrow alleys of old Delhi. Be amazed by the serene beauty of the Taj Mahal at sunrise. Wonder the blended Hindu, Buddhist and Islamic architecture in the palaces of Emperor Akbar’s deserted city, Fatehpur Sikri. Relish the glory of Kachwaha architecture and culture in the City Palace of the pink city, Jaipur.  The masonry instruments of the astronomical observatory of Maharaja Sawai Jai Singh still function. Enjoy a ride on beautifully decorated elephants up to the hilltop palaces of Maharaja Man Singh and Mirza Raja Jai Singh at Amber Fort. Experience the ancient Hindu rituals on the banks of River Ganga in Varanasi - the eternal Hindu holy city where 2500 years ago the Buddha came to learn scriptures after renouncing his worldly life. The intricate sculptures of Khajuraho Hindu temples are amazing. Relish a relaxing boat ride on Pichola Lake in Udaipur. Stay in centrally located luxury hotels. Continental, vegan and vegetarian cuisine can be especially arranged for you.


Itinerary: New Delhi, Varanasi, Khajuraho, Orchha, Agra, Fatehpur Sikri, Jaipur and Udaipur.

  • Day 1, DEPARTURE US AIRPORT.
  • Day 2, Delhi:
    Arrive in Indira Gandhi International Airport, New Delhi. Traditional welcome with “Tilak” and fresh flower garland and transfer to Ramada Plaza Hotel.
  • Day 3, Delhi – Varanasi
    After breakfast drive to Raj Ghat (Mahatma Gandhi’s memorial on the banks of River Yamuna), drive past Red Fort, with stop for photography, to Emperor Shahjahan’s Jama Masjid. Later Rickshaw ride in Chandni Chawk Bazaar in Old Delhi. In the afternoon transfer to airport to board the Spice Jet flight to Varanasi (arrival 3.45 PM). Sightseeing of Man Mandir Palace with astronomical observatory. Later enjoy the Ganga Aartee ceremony at the banks of the holy river. Overnight in Ideal Tower Hotel.
  • Day 4, Varanasi - Khajuraho:
    Early morning boat ride to view sunrise on River Ganga and the Hindu morning rituals. Later sightseeing of temples on the banks of the river in the ancient city and the New Vishwanath Temple in the Banaras Hindu University campus area. In the afternoon sightseeing of Sarnath, the deer park where the Buddha preached his first sermon to start the wheel of religion, the Dharmachakra. Overnight in Ideal Tower Hotel.
  • Day 5, Khajuraho:
    The morning is free to relax. Later transfer to airport to board the Kingfisher flight to Khajuraho. In the afternoon visit the three groups of Hindu and Jain Temples. Overnight in Usha Bundela Hotel
  • Day 6, Khajuraho - Orchha - Jhansi - Agra:
    After breakfast proceed to Orchha. After lunch at Orchha Resort, sightseeing of Orchha Fort and the two Hindu Temples on the way to Jhansi. Transfer to railway station to board train # 2002 Bhopal Shatabdi Express departing from Jhansi at 1530 Hrs and arriving in Agra at 2010 Hrs (train runs daily except on Fridays, on Friday Taj Express Train will be used). On arrival in Agra, transfer to and overnight in Howard Park Plaza Hotel.
  • Day 7, Agra:
    Early in the morning drive a short distance to the parking lot of the Taj Mahal. Ride battery cars or horse tongas to the eastern gate of the world famous monument to love. Ample time to enjoy the vast walled enclosure of the world famous Taj Mahal. After breakfast at hotel there marvel at the craftsmanship at marble factory where traditional artisans still work using similar hand operated implements similar to those that their forefathers used more than 300 years ago when they worked to build the Taj Mahal. Later drive to the Red Fort of Agra to visit the red sandstone palaces of Emperor Akbar and the white marble palaces that his grandson Emperor Shahjahan replaced in Red Fort of Agra. Emperor Aurangzeb, the son of Emperor Shahjahan kept him a prisoner in his own palaces for the last 8 years of his life. Overnight in Howard Park Plaza Hotel.
  • Day 8, Agra - Fatehpur Sikri- Jaipur:
    Breakfast at hotel and proceed to Jaipur with stop to visit Fatehpur Sikri, Emperor Akbar’s deserted capital. Visit the palaces complex and the mosque with the white marble tomb of Sufi saint Sheikh Salim Chistie after driving 40 kilometers or 25 miles further from Agra. Later proceed to Jaipur & check into hotel. After lunch sightseeing of the Kachhwaha Maharajas’ City Palace to visit the fascinating textiles gallery in Mubarak Mahal, the Sarvatobhadra (Hall of Private Audience) with the two famous Gangajallis (Silver Urns to carry Ganga River water), the colorful courtyard of Chandra Mahal with its Peacock Gate and the “Diwan-i-Am” Art Gallery that houses some of the most famous Mughal and Rajasthani miniature paintings. Stepping out of the City Palace we will visit the Astronomical Observatory that is largest one built by the founder of Jaipur, Sawai Jai Singh. All except one of its 17 astronomical instruments are still functional. Overnight in Ramada Plaza Hotel.
  • Day 9, Jaipur–Amber-Udaipur:
    After breakfast check-out and visit Amber Fort to enjoy the Elephant ride ascending to the hilltop palaces of Mirza Raja Jai Singh and Maharaja Mansingh. Return by Jeep after sightseeing. Afternoon free to relax on your own. After dinner transfer to railway station to board the overnight train in first class compartment to Udaipur. Overnight in train.
  • Day 10, Udaipur:
    Arrival at Udaipur Railway Station at 6.10 AM. Transfer to hotel. After breakfast sightseeing of Udaipur City Palace of the Maharanas and Jagdish Temple. After lunch boat ride on Pichola Lake to view Jagniwas Lake Palace and sightseeing of Jagmandir Island Palace. Later transfer to airport to board the Jet Airways flight at 5.30 PM to arrive in Delhi at 6.40 PM. Overnight in Ramada Plaza Hotel.
  • Day 11, Udaipur-Delhi-USA:
    After breakfast transfer to airport to board the morning flight to Delhi. After lunch start the New Delhi sightseeing including Qutub Minar, Humayun’s Tomb, a brief stop at Baha’i Lotus Temple for photography and drive past President’s Mansion, Prime Minister’s office, Parliament House and India Gate in the part of New Delhi designed by the British architects, Edwin Lutyens and James Baker. Later farewell dinner and transfer to Indira Gandhi International Airport to board the flight back to USA.
